Range and Efficiency

The Renault Scenic E-Tech EV60 170hp (2023-...) boasts a greater real-world range, a larger battery, and superior energy efficiency compared to the MG ZS EV Standard Range (2021-…).

Property MG ZS EV Standard Range Renault Scenic E-Tech 60 kWh 170 hp
Range (WLTP) 199 mi 267 mi
Range (GCC) 169 mi 231 mi
Battery Capacity (Nominal) 51.1 kWh 65 kWh
Battery Capacity (Usable) 49 kWh 60 kWh
Efficiency per 100 mi 29 kWh/100 mi 26 kWh/100 mi
Efficiency per kWh 3.45 mi/kWh 3.85 mi/kWh

Charging

Both vehicles utilize a standard 400-volt architecture.

The Renault Scenic E-Tech EV60 170hp (2023-...) offers faster charging speeds at DC stations, reaching up to 130 kW, while the MG ZS EV Standard Range (2021-…) maxes out at 75 kW.

The Renault Scenic E-Tech EV60 170hp (2023-...) features a more powerful on-board charger, supporting a maximum AC charging power of 22 kW, whereas the MG ZS EV Standard Range (2021-…) is limited to 6.6 kW.

Property MG ZS EV Standard Range Renault Scenic E-Tech 60 kWh 170 hp
Max Charging Power (AC) 6.6 kW 22 kW
Max Charging Power (DC) 75 kW 130 kW
Architecture 400 V 400 V
Charge Port CCS Type 2 CCS Type 2

Performance

Both vehicles are front-wheel drive.

Both cars deliver the same 0-60 mph acceleration time, but the MG ZS EV Standard Range (2021-…) boasts greater motor power.

Property MG ZS EV Standard Range Renault Scenic E-Tech 60 kWh 170 hp
Drive Type FWD FWD
Motor Type PMSM EESM
Motor Power (kW) 130 kW 125 kW
Motor Power (hp) 174 hp 168 hp
Motor Torque 207 lb-ft 207 lb-ft
0-60 mph 8.3 s 8.3 s
Top Speed 109 mph 93 mph

Cargo and Towing

The Renault Scenic E-Tech EV60 170hp (2023-...) provides more cargo capacity, featuring both a larger trunk and more space with the rear seats folded.

Neither car is equipped with a frunk (front trunk).

The Renault Scenic E-Tech EV60 170hp (2023-...) is better suited for heavy loads, offering a greater towing capacity than the MG ZS EV Standard Range (2021-…).

Property MG ZS EV Standard Range Renault Scenic E-Tech 60 kWh 170 hp
Number of Seats 5 5
Curb Weight 3626 lb 3874 lb
Cargo Volume (Trunk) 15.8 ft3 19.2 ft3
Cargo Volume (Max) 41.2 ft3 59 ft3
